For an applied research project, we are seeking a highly motivated Postdoc interested in the development of a hybrid AM manufacturing process for silicon carbide ceramics. This project is a close collaboration between the Smart Materials Processing and Architectured Materials groups of the laboratory and focuses on the design, fabrication and characterization of 3D-printed SiC-based ceramic metamaterials. We will develop SiC-based thermoplastic feedstocks, a hybrid manufacturing process combining FDM 3D printing and milling, design metamaterials with unique properties, and analyze their microstructural, mechanical, and thermal properties after sintering.
Your tasks
- Exploring commercial SiC ceramic powder and sintering additives
- Development of SiC thermoplastic feedstocks for FDM printing
- Programming of an existing hybrid FDM printing machine, including printing and milling devices
- Modelling and optimization of the debinding process
- Simulation-based design of mechanical metamaterials to achieve high specific stiffness and strength, energy dissipation, and damage resistance
- Morphological, microstructural, and mechanical characterization of the 3D printed metamaterials
